在转化ACAD图纸的过程中,经常出现字体不匹配,出现乱码等问题,现将部分问题的解决方法分享。1.ACAD的低版本文件,如R13(及R13以下)的DWG文件,用R14(及R14以上)版本打开时,即使正确地选择了汉字字形文件,还是会出现汉字乱码,原因是R14(及R14以上)与R13(及R13以下)采用的代码页不同。解决办法:可到AutoDesk公司主页下载代码页转换工具wnewcp工具进行转换,如原图为简体中文,选择转换为GB2312或ANSI936均可。
在转化ACAD图纸的过程中,经常出现字体不匹配,出现乱码等问题,现将部分问题的解决方法分享。
1.ACAD的低版本文件,如R13(及R13以下)的DWG文件,用R14(及R14以上)版本打开时,即使正确地选择了汉字字形文件,还是会出现汉字乱码,原因是R14(及R14以上)与R13(及R13以下)采用的代码页不同。解决办法:可到AutoDesk公司主页下载代码页转换工具wnewcp工具进行转换,如原图为简体中文,选择转换为GB2312或ANSI936均可。
2.在一个块里写字,如在标题栏里写字,一些内容太长造成文字出界,在acad2000以前的版本里无法调整块里面的文字属性(即无法调整块中块),只能采用炸开的办法再调整文字属性。解决办法:升级到acad2002,它的块里面可以更改下一层块的属性。
3.当数字与文字混合输入时,高度不一,通常来说数字比文字的高度大一点。解决办法:我通常数字用用style指令指定数字用GBENOR字体(ACAD自带,字高比其它字体矮),文字用HZTXT字体(如没有HZTXT字体,可根据感觉另选字体代替)。
4.打开其他公司的CAD图纸,提示无图纸中的某字体,但用其他字体替代后,出现乱码。解决办法:新建一文档,将该CAD图纸作为一个块插入,乱码将会消失(但字体会与原图有出入,若需100%准确,则需要对方通过匹配的字体)。
5.用中文版的PROE中Pro/Drawing出好的工程图,当你把它转成DWG后用AutoCAD打开后,你无论在ACAD中如何设中文字体,把它炸开(因文字由PROE转DWG时全成图块了),都无法正常显示PROE中的中文字体。解决办法:转时先不要直接转成DWG格式,先转成DXF格式(这样在ACAD中文字就不会成为一个图块),再用AutoCAD打开这个DXF文件,这时此ACAD文件字体风格是纯英文字符,用style指令来改变字体风格,采用BIG FONT,选一种较为合适的中文字体,然后应用,你会发现,PROE中标的中文字全回复过来了。经网友试验,SYFS.SHX字体与,PROE的字体相差无几。
6.图纸为实心字,打引印时出现空心字体。解决办法:将ACAD参数TEXTFILL的参数值由0改为1。
2楼
1. 执行编辑命令,提示选择目标时,用矩形框方式选择,从左向右拖动光标,为"窗口Windows"方式,如果从右向左拖动光标,则为"交叉 Cross"方式。
2. 相对坐标输入点时,在正交状态时,一般输入为:@x,0或@0,y (例如输入相对坐标“@100,0”表示下一点相对上一点X方向增加100,又如输入
相对坐标“@0,50”表示下一点相对上一点Y方向增加50),以上两种情况下,可以直接输入100或50即可实现相同的目的,从而节省输入时间。
3. 在AutoCAD中有时有交叉点标记在鼠标点击处产生,用BLIPMODE命令,在提示行下输入OFF可消除它。
4. 有的用户使用AutoCAD时会发现命令中的对话框会变成提示行,如打印命令,控制它的是系统变量CMDDIA,关掉它就行了。
5. 椭圆命令生成的椭圆是以多义线还是以椭圆为实体的是由系统变量PELLIPSE决定,当其为1时,生成的椭圆是PLINE。
6. CMDECHO变量决定了命令行回显是否产生,其在程序执行中应设为0。
7. DIMSCALE决定了尺寸标注的比例,其值为整数,缺省为1,在图形有了一定比例缩放时应最好将其改成为缩放比例。
8. CAD的较高版本中提供了形位公差标注,但圆度及同轴度中的圆不够圆,其实,AutoCAD中常见符号定义都在AutoCAD安装目录下SUPPORT子义了圆形的形状,圆的弧度竟为127°,但不太好改正之(如改为90°更不好看)。
9. 空心汉字字形如使用AutoCAD R14中的BONUS功能(一定要完全安装AutoCAD,或自定义安装时选了它),有一个TXTEXP命令,可将文本炸为
10. AutoCAD R14的BONUS中有一个ARCTEXT命令,可实现弧形文本输出,使用方法为先选圆弧,再输入文本内容,按OK。
11. BONUS中有一个有用的命令,即MPEDIT,用它将多个线一齐修改为多义线,再改它的线宽。
12. Image命令在R14中代替了R13中的BMPIN、PCXIN之类的命令,它将位图嵌入文件中,只用来显示,如炸开就成了空框架,如何使用PCXIN等命令重现?请将R13安装目录下的RASTERIN.EXE拷入R14下,用appload将其装入,然后就可以将位图导入(可编缉,可炸开)了。
13. BREAK命令用来打断实体,用户也可以一点断开实体,用法是在第一点选择后,输入“@”。常用一条线一段为点划线,另一段为实线时。
14. AutoCAD R14中提供了大量的命令缩写,许多R13中无缩写的命令也有了缩写,下面提供了CAD中的单字符缩写:A:ARC,B:Bmake,C:Circle,D:ddim,E:erase,F:fillet,G:group,H:bhatch,I:ddinsert,L:line,M:move,O:offset,P:pan,R:redraw,S:stretch,T:mext,U:undo,V:ddview,W:Wblock,X;explode,Z:zoo,可大量使用之,使用后会发现比鼠标点取快(尤其在ls输5个字符的速度下)。AutoCAD R14大量扩充了简化命令,不仅增加了以首字母简化的命令(这里不列出),而用增加了用前两个字母简化的命令,常的如:array 、copy、 dist、 donut 、dtext 、filter 、mirror、 pline 、rotate 、trim、 scale 、snap 、style、 units等,更加提高了用键盘输入命令的速度,对熟悉键盘的朋友来说简直是如虎添翼。
15. AutoCAD R14命令的缩写也可用在R13,方法是将AutoCAD R14下的Support子目录下的ACAD.pgp拷贝至AutoCAD R13中的Support子目录下。
16. AutoCAD 中ACAD.pgp文件十分重要,它记录命令缩写内容,用户可自定义它们,格式如下:<命令缩写> *命令名称。也可定义系统命令,AutoCAD R14提供了sh命令,可执行DOS命令,但在Windows作用下不大。
17. AutoCAD R14中用NOTEPAD、EDIT、DIR、DEL等系统命令,笔者认为其中NOTEPAD对自定义CAD用途较大,但使用起来会发现屏幕一闪(进了DOS),又返回,十分让人不愉快,让我们来编一个小程序,取名为note.lsp:
(defun c:notepad)
(startapp″notepad″)
先将ACAD.pgp中的NOTEPAD命令定义行删除,重入CAD后,再将此程序命令:(load″note″)装入,下一次用NOTEPAD命令会有更好效果,最好将(load″note″)加入Support子目录下的ACADR14.lsp中。
18. AutoCAD R14中打印线宽可由颜色设定,这样机械制图中的各种线型不同、、线宽不同的线条可放入不同的层,在层中定义了线型的颜色,而在打印设置中设定线型与颜色的关系,效果良好。
19. AutoCAD R14的Support中ACAD.dwt为缺省模板,要好好加工它,把常用的层、块、标注类型定义好,再加上标准图框,可省去大量重复工作。
20. AutoCAD中有不少外部Lisp命令文件,可以直接观察它们,如果学习开发Lisp应用程序,注意;R14可是最后一版Lisp文件内容公开的AUTOCAD,在CAD2000中Lisp文件内容是加密的(笔者正在研究解密程序)。
21. AutoCAD二次开发工具很多,Lisp早就有了,R11提供了ADS(Acad Develop system),R12中提供了ADS对实模式下C编译器(如BC,MS C)的支持,R13提供ARX(Acad Runtime eXtend),R14提供了 VB Automation,这个Automation使VB编写CAD程序成为可能,渴望CAD编程的人有了一个最好的选择,不必学习ADS、ARX、Object ARX和AutoLisp,一起加入AutoCAD编程的世界。
22. 用户自定义的Lisp文件一定要自动装入AutoCAD,这样就需要在acadr14.lsp中加入用户Lisp文件的装入语句,acadr14.lsp(早期版本为acad14.lsp)好似DOS的Autoexec.bat,一定要好好利用,在其中如定义了名为S::STARTUP()的函数可自动运行它。(给CAD加个启用画面如何,可用STARTUP加startapp函数,也可加登录密码)。
23. 将AutoCAD中的图形插入WORD中,有时会发现圆变成了正多边形,用一下VIEWRES命令,将它设得大一些,可改变图形质量。
24. 形如φ30H11(+0.1,-0.2)的标注如何去标呢,请在文本内容中输入%%c30{H11(){\H0.7X;\S+0.1^-0.2;}}”,可以实现,如嫌太麻烦,就编程序来简化操作。
25. AutoCAD中文件可当作块插入其他文件中,但这样一来过多的块使文件过于庞大,用PURGE来清除它们吧,一次清一层,一定要多用几次呀!
26. AutoCAD R14的帮助文件内容十分丰富,由很多本“书”组成,一层层打开,多看它们用处是很大的,其中包括了CAD的各方面,比任何CAD大全还全,你是否想您的帮助加入其中,请修改acad.cnt,加入自己帮助的链接。
字数超四千了..
CAD小技巧多多
http://www.tgnet.cn/Info/Detail/2006/12/01/200612011109948263.aspx
回复
3楼
CAD小技巧多多
http://www.tgnet.cn/Info/Detail/2006/12/01/200612011109948263.aspx
死了都要顶
不顶到最后不痛快
做设计只有这样
才足够洗白
死了都要顶
不顶到痛哭不痛快
宇宙毁灭还在顶
把每天
当成是发贴来更顶
一分一秒
都顶到泪水掉下来
不理会
业主是看好或看坏
只要你勇敢
全部顶
顶
不用顶得太快
你顶得越快他的意见也就越快
顶到现在
别一说顶就怕受伤害
许多好贴我们相信
全靠顶出来!
死了都要顶
不推翻重来不痛快
做设计师
只有这样
才足够洗白
死了都要顶
不顶到痛哭不痛快
宇宙毁灭贴还在
鸟瞰一千都要顶
不折磨你他不痛快
发会雪白
贴会掩埋
贴子它还在!
到绝路都要顶
不天荒地老不痛快
三个通宵不奇怪!
顶到最后全变态!
回复
4楼
死了都要顶
不顶到最后不痛快
做设计只有这样
才足够洗白
死了都要顶
不顶到痛哭不痛快
宇宙毁灭还在顶
把每天
当成是发贴来更顶
一分一秒
都顶到泪水掉下来
不理会
业主是看好或看坏
只要你勇敢
全部顶
顶
不用顶得太快
你顶得越快他的意见也就越快
顶到现在
别一说顶就怕受伤害
许多好贴我们相信
全靠顶出来!
死了都要顶
不推翻重来不痛快
做设计师
只有这样
才足够洗白
死了都要顶
不顶到痛哭不痛快
宇宙毁灭贴还在
鸟瞰一千都要顶
不折磨你他不痛快
发会雪白
贴会掩埋
贴子它还在!
到绝路都要顶
不天荒地老不痛快
三个通宵不奇怪!
顶到最后全变态!
回复
5楼
呵呵...
回复
6楼
谢谢楼主的分享 真是好人啊 找了好多字体但还是有乱码 希望这次可以解决
回复
7楼
支持!
回复
8楼
死了都要顶
不顶到最后不痛快
回复
9楼
死了都要顶
不顶到最后不痛快
做设计只有这样
才足够洗白
死了都要顶
不顶到痛哭不痛快
宇宙毁灭还在顶
把每天
当成是发贴来更顶
一分一秒
都顶到泪水掉下来
不理会
业主是看好或看坏
只要你勇敢
全部顶
顶
不用顶得太快
你顶得越快他的意见也就越快
顶到现在
别一说顶就怕受伤害
许多好贴我们相信
全靠顶出来!
死了都要顶
不推翻重来不痛快
做设计师
只有这样
才足够洗白
死了都要顶
不顶到痛哭不痛快
宇宙毁灭贴还在
鸟瞰一千都要顶
不折磨你他不痛快
发会雪白
贴会掩埋
贴子它还在!
到绝路都要顶
不天荒地老不痛快
三个通宵不奇怪!
顶到最后全变态
回复
10楼
10.【保存的格式】
OP----打开和保存----另存为2000格式
为什么要存2000格式呢
因为CAD版本只向下兼容
这样用2002 2004 2006都可以打开了
方便操作
别在这里在说,你还用R14
那么我会说你太落后了~
11.【如果想下次打印的线型和这次的一样怎么办】
换言之.【如何保存打印列表】
op选项-----打印------添加打印列表
但在这之前,你得自己建立一个属于自己的例表
表告诉我你不会建
~~~~~~~
12.【如果在标题栏显示路径不全怎么办】
op选项---------打开和保存----------在标题栏中显示完整路径(勾选 )即可
13.【目标捕捉(OSNAP)有用吗】?
答:用处很大。尤其绘制精度要求较高的机械图样时,目标捕捉是精确定点的最佳工具。Autodesk公司对此也是非常重视,每次版本升级,目标捕捉的功能都有很大提高。切忌用光标线直接定点,
回复
11楼
死了都要顶
不顶到最后不痛快
做设计只有这样
才足够洗白
死了都要顶
不顶到痛哭不痛快
宇宙毁灭还在顶
把每天
当成是发贴来更顶
一分一秒
都顶到泪水掉下来
不理会
业主是看好或看坏
只要你勇敢
全部顶
顶
不用顶得太快
你顶得越快他的意见也就越快
顶到现在
别一说顶就怕受伤害
许多好贴我们相信
全靠顶出来!
死了都要顶
不推翻重来不痛快
做设计师
只有这样
才足够洗白
死了都要顶
不顶到痛哭不痛快
宇宙毁灭贴还在
鸟瞰一千都要顶
不折磨你他不痛快
发会雪白
贴会掩埋
贴子它还在!
到绝路都要顶
不天荒地老不痛快
三个通宵不奇怪!
顶到最后全变态!
回复